Linux下使用Android Studio命令直接运行
在Linux系统中,使用Android Studio进行Android应用程序的开发是非常常见的。通常情况下,我们会通过图形界面操作来运行Android应用程序。但是,有时候我们可能需要通过命令行来运行Android Studio以及相关的命令。本文将介绍如何在Linux系统下使用Android Studio命令直接运行。
安装Android Studio
首先,我们需要在Linux系统中安装Android Studio。在命令行中执行以下命令来下载并安装Android Studio:
sudo apt update
sudo apt install android-studio
安装完成后,通过以下命令来启动Android Studio:
studio.sh
使用命令行运行Android应用程序
在Android Studio中,我们可以使用命令行来运行Android应用程序。首先,我们需要进入到我们的Android项目的根目录。假设我们的Android项目位于/home/user/MyApp
目录下,我们可以通过以下命令进入到该目录:
cd /home/user/MyApp
接下来,我们可以使用以下命令来构建并运行我们的Android应用程序:
./gradlew installDebug
这个命令会构建并安装我们的应用程序到连接的Android设备或模拟器上。如果一切顺利,我们的应用程序将会自动启动。
使用命令行安装应用程序
除了运行应用程序,我们还可以使用命令行来安装我们的应用程序到设备或模拟器上。假设我们的应用程序的APK文件位于/home/user/MyApp/app/build/outputs/apk/debug/app-debug.apk
,我们可以使用以下命令来安装应用程序:
adb install /home/user/MyApp/app/build/outputs/apk/debug/app-debug.apk
这个命令会将应用程序安装到连接的Android设备或模拟器上。
使用命令行运行特定的Activity
有时候,我们可能只想运行应用程序中的某个特定的Activity。我们可以使用以下命令来运行特定的Activity:
adb shell am start -n com.example.myapp/.MainActivity
这个命令会启动应用程序中名为MainActivity
的Activity。
使用命令行卸载应用程序
如果我们想要卸载我们的应用程序,我们可以使用以下命令:
adb uninstall com.example.myapp
这个命令会将名为com.example.myapp
的应用程序卸载。
总结
通过本文,我们了解了如何在Linux系统中使用Android Studio命令直接运行Android应用程序。我们学会了如何使用命令行构建、运行、安装、卸载Android应用程序,以及如何运行特定的Activity。使用命令行可以提高我们的开发效率,特别是在自动化构建和部署过程中。
希望本文对你有所帮助。祝你在Linux系统上的Android开发工作顺利!